Discovering Trogir’s Rich History

As you stroll through Trogir, you’ll quickly realize that its rich history is woven into every cobblestone and facade.

This UNESCO World Heritage town, founded in the 3rd century BC, showcases a blend of Romanesque, Gothic, and Renaissance architecture. Each narrow street you wander reveals stories of ancient civilizations and vibrant local culture.

You’ll notice remnants of the past, from the stunning Cathedral of St. Lawrence to the fortress walls that once protected the town.

Key Landmarks of the Tour

While exploring Trogir, visitors encounter a remarkable array of key landmarks that showcase the town’s historical and architectural significance.

The Cathedral of St. Lawrence, with its exquisite portal by master Radovan, stands as a highlight. Karmelengo Fortress and St. Mark Tower offer stunning views, while the Town Gate and Town Hall reflect the town’s medieval charm.

Don’t miss the St. Sebastian Clocktower, Big Loggia, and the serene St. Dominic’s Church.

The Big Stone Bridge connects visitors to other parts of the town, making it easy to wander through the narrow streets and soak in Trogir’s rich heritage.
